What is a 6-Foot Storage Container?

A 6-foot storage container is a portable storage system usually made from long lasting steel or top-quality metal. It is created to supply safe and weather-resistant storage for numerous products. With dimensions determining around 6 feet in length, with differing widths and heights, these containers are ideal for both short-lived and long-lasting storage services.

1. Residential Storage

Numerous individuals utilize 6-foot storage containers to declutter their homes or shop seasonal products, such as vacation designs, garden equipment, and sports equipment. These containers supply an efficient way to keep personal belongings safe while maximizing space within the home.

2. Commercial Applications

Businesses often use 6-foot storage containers for stock management, tool storage, and even as portable workplaces. Their compact size permits them to suit tight spaces without sacrificing security or ease of access.

3. Occasion and Festival Storage

For outside occasions and celebrations, these containers can provide a temporary service for saving equipment, products, and personal valuables. Their movement makes it easy to transport them to various places as needed.

4. Building Sites

Building business often use 6-foot storage containers to secure tools and materials at task sites. Their robust style secures valuable devices and supplies from theft and the components.

Key Considerations When Choosing a 6-Foot Storage Container

  1. Material Quality: Ensure the container is made of premium, durable materials to withstand the components and possible wear and tear.
  2. Locking Mechanism: Opt for a container with safe locking functions to protect important products stored within.
  3. Ventilation: Look for containers that offer ventilation options to prevent wetness accumulation, which can cause mold and mildew.
  4. Rental vs. Purchase: Decide in between leasing or buying a container based on long-term needs. Leasing may be more suitable for momentary storage, while purchasing is ideal for long-term requirements.
  5. Ease of access: Consider how easily you can access the contents of the container.  read more  with broad doors and appropriate height can improve use.

How to Maximize Storage Space in a 6-Foot Container

Successfully arranging area within a 6-foot container can assist make the most of storage capacity while supplying ease of access to saved items. Below are a couple of strategies to accomplish this:

Practical Storage Tips

  1. Use Shelving Units: Adding vertical shelving can produce extra storage area, permitting you to store products on several levels.
  2. Stackable Containers: Utilize stackable bins or boxes to store smaller items, making it easier to arrange and access your personal belongings.
  3. Produce an Inventory List: Keeping a stock list of your saved products can assist you quickly locate what you need without rummaging through the entire container.
  4. Classify Items: Sort items by classification (e.g., tools, vacation design, seasonal clothes) to enhance organization and availability.
